Transaction 13f7d04111bb42e80d8267b6423b43266bb49f14af85cc1725c8bcf78c7aeb5f

45 Input
2 Outputs
  • 13f7d04111bb42e80d8267b6423b43266bb49f14af85cc1725c8bcf78c7aeb5f:0
  • value  3267663
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 13f7d04111bb42e80d8267b6423b43266bb49f14af85cc1725c8bcf78c7aeb5f:1
  • value  278768647
    address  38K1i8EESBieYHGu2DB7C2KamRk4zs3y3K